3. Seller Delivery Responsibilities


The seller must deliver the asset according to the listing, transaction agreement, and platform instructions. Delivery may include:


  • • Domain ownership transfer or registrar push.
  • • Website file, database, hosting, and DNS migration.
  • • Source code repository transfer or downloadable source delivery.
  • • SaaS product handover, admin access transition, and documentation.
  • • Mobile app source, developer account transition where permitted, and release documentation.
  • • Business asset documentation, operating procedures, and agreed account/access transfer.
  • • Credential rotation, access verification, and removal of seller-only access after transfer.

5. Buyer Inspection Period


Marketplace transactions have a default inspection period of 3 (three) days after the seller marks the digital asset as delivered, unless a different period is shown on the transaction page. Biznaire may apply a shorter or longer inspection period depending on asset type, transaction value, delivery complexity, risk review, or agreement between the parties.


During the inspection period, the buyer must review the asset, test access, check documentation, and either confirm completion or raise a dispute before the inspection period expires.


If the buyer takes no action before the inspection period expires, the transaction may complete automatically and seller payout may be initiated.

8. Security During Delivery


Users must not share unnecessary sensitive information. Passwords, API keys, recovery phrases, private keys, and administrative credentials should be transferred only when required and through secure methods. After transfer, buyers should rotate credentials and sellers should remove retained access unless otherwise agreed.
